S. 58(c) TPA | Mere Possession Of Property By Mortgagor Wouldn't Make 'Mortgage By Conditional Sale' A 'Simple Mortgage' : Supreme Court

The Supreme Court observed that allowing a mortgagor to stay in possession does not make the transaction a 'simple mortgage' if the deed specifies that the mortgagor's default in redeeming the property within the stipulated time would lead to transfer of the mortgage property to the mortgagee under 'mortgage by conditional sale' as per Section 58 of the Transfer of Property Act, 1882. • Terms of the Mortgage Deed: The mortgage deed allowed the defendant to use the land and specified that the right of the mortgagor to reclaim the property would be extinguished upon default.” Setting aside the impugned decisions, the judgment authored by Justice Vikram Nath observed that the courts below erred in not holding the transactions as mortgage by conditional sale as all the ingredients of Section 58 TPA stand fulfilled. Moreover, the court noted that the plaintiff's possession over the mortgaged property would be deemed as 'permissive possession', disentitling him to claim additional benefits out of the mortgage deed.
